The emergence of the auteur theory as a critical method of analysing directors and their work was born in 1950’s post-World War II France, where Paris became the epicentre of youthful rebellion and where the sudden craving for anarchy and desire for the oppositional was rife. In this essay for the sake of space I will mainly be discussing arguably three of the most popular films directed by Hitchcock which are: Vertigo, Psycho and The Birds. The journal during this period aimed to legitimise cinema as an art form, locate a films artistic quality through configuration of cinematic devices, conceptualise the director above all other creative forces and make distinctions between functionally competent directors, known as mettuers-en-scene, and those directors who demonstrate a strong artistic signature that unifies their films, gaining them auteur status and Hitchcock was the perfect contender for each of these categories. Jefferies, along with the other four male protagonists, all embody Jacques Lacan’s theory of the mirror stage in which the male child moves from the imaginary; being connected to its mother, to observing their own reflection in the mirror and recognising their physical difference from the mother and thus moving into the symbolic phase where the male child disconnects from the mother.
